Crypto Charity: A New Era of Giving

Crypto charity is transforming how people support causes worldwide. By using blockchain technology, donations become faster, more transparent, and accessible across borders. Donors can track exactly where their funds go, reducing fraud and increasing trust. Cryptocurrencies also make it easier for people in underserved regions to receive aid without relying on traditional banking systems. While challenges like market volatility and regulation remain, the potential is undeniable. As digital currencies grow, crypto charity could redefine global philanthropy, making giving more efficient, inclusive, and impactful for both donors and recipients in an increasingly connected world.

Challenges

  • Price volatility of cryptocurrencies
  • Limited awareness among donors
  • Regulatory uncertainty in some countries
